Haas expands partnership with RUCKUS Networks

Aditya Chaudhuri Aditya Chaudhuri

American Formula One team Haas have announced a partnership expansion with global supplier of advanced wireless systems for the mobile internet infrastructure market, RUCKUS Networks, who will take up the role of the team’s Official Networking Partner before the start of the Formula One 2026 season onwards. RUCKUS Networks will use their solutions to help the team increase performance on and off the track,connecting the team trackside to the factory, securely, with low latency. RUCKUS Networks will also have branding on the Haas race car, driver race suits,  team kit, t garage, and also on Haas’ digital assets.

Ayao Komatsu, Team Principal of TGR Haas F1 Team, commented,

“Strong, reliable connectivity is fundamental to our global operations, and I’m pleased to be working with RUCKUS Networks during an important year for the sport. Formula 1 is about speed, efficiency, and reliability, and partnering with RUCKUS Networks allows us to showcase how our networking solutions perform in one of the most data-intensive environments in the world.”

Bart Giordano, SVP and President, RUCKUS Networks, added,

“We’re expanding our initial partnership to be the Official Networking Partner of the TGR Haas F1 Team, and we couldn’t be more thrilled. Speed and excellence are synonymous with the team, and we know our purpose-driven networks can meet and exceed the demand for performance in an ultracompetitive environment. RUCKUS leads the industry with our innovative AI-driven solutions, that competitive edge will lend to this partnership. We’re excited to have our technology continue to enable TGR Haas F1 Team’s networks and we can’t wait to support them again moving forward in the sport.”
